**Night Shift — Recording Studio (Room 4B)**

The Fennick Media training studio runs unattended overnight. Check the booking sheet before entering. Power down lights and teleprompter after any maintenance. Do not move camera rigs; they are marked on the floor. Report faults in the night log, not by phone. Lock the equipment cage before leaving. The studio door uses a keypad; enter with the code below.

badge for fahap-kahof: bdg-EQUNTN-00774017

## Onboarding: Color-Contrast Accessibility Audit

The Brightgate audit job scans every deployed page of the Fernwick portal nightly and flags text pairs below a 4.5:1 contrast ratio. As on-call, you'll mostly see pages where a theme override slipped past review. Findings land in the audit dashboard; triage anything marked critical within one business day. The job runs headless against production and reads its config from the standard env file. Its dashboard write access is granted by the credential on the next line.

sealed setting: COURIER_KEY29=170ad45524657711572101e080d15

Subject: Quickstore 4.2 — bloom filter now fronts the KV layer

Plugin authors: starting with this release, Quickstore places a bloom filter ahead of the key-value store. Negative lookups return faster; false positives fall through safely. No API changes are required on your side. Verify your plugin against the staging build referenced below.

session token of fahif-tadup = htk3_9c7

TICKET-4182: TileForge cache vault locked after failed rotation

While reviewing the tile-rendering cache layer, note that the Quillbrook vault sealed itself mid-rotation, blocking warm-cache writes for the raster pipeline. The unseal flow requires manual approval before merge. To reproduce the recovery path locally, unlock the staging vault with the passphrase below.

unlock words, hahip-baduf: holwyn-istath-julvan